The pit is the area directly in front of the stage, it's usually called General Admission when you purchase tickets because there are no seats, everyone just stands up and dances, etc. There are no assigned spots either, so f you want to be front row, you need to have pit tickets and get there early so that you have the best chance of running up to the front when the doors open.

The stands or seating is just like bleachers at a stadium. There are seats so you can sit down, and you can arrive whenever, your ticket guarantees you your spot. The downside is that you are farther away from the band and can't move closer.
